Transaction e26421c41120c9d774ef7c2adc1aedc1d7a4c9642fc39abaf68bc89919852b61
1 Input
1 Output
-
e26421c41120c9d774ef7c2adc1aedc1d7a4c9642fc39abaf68bc89919852b61:0
- value
- 90222616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c29a4335f820f1949a2e81c91e49d41e4bc40773 OP_EQUAL
- address
- MRe87zeC2VHbyaVr4w6N9EhupCyeqS5Wrf